Job Openings Senior Backend Engineer - Media & Platform Services (Java + NodeJS + AWS)

About the job Senior Backend Engineer - Media & Platform Services (Java + NodeJS + AWS)

About the client

Our client is a VC-backed startup on a mission to transform how design teams create branded content through generative AI. They're building a world-class AI team that blends cutting-edge research with product-driven engineering to create tools that designers love.

They value autonomy, technical excellence, and bold thinking. If you're excited to push the boundaries of what's possible in generative AI while delivering tangible impact, they'd love to hear from you.

Role Overview

They're looking for a Senior Backend Engineer with deep expertise in Java Spring Boot, Node.js, and AWS to join their platform team. 

In this role, you'll help architect and build high-performance backend services that power the company's media processing, content export, and creative delivery workflows. You'll play a key role in scaling their infrastructure to meet the demands of world-class design teams and creative professionals.

Key Responsibilities

  • Lead the development of scalable media services, including file conversions (image, animation, video), compression, and rendering workflows
  • Design and implement serverless and event-driven architectures (e.g., AWS Lambda, SQS) to orchestrate large-scale media pipelines
  • Build robust backend APIs for multi-format template exports, real-time previews, and smart content rendering
  • Optimize media pipelines using tools like FFmpeg and canvas-node to ensure high-quality, low-latency outputs
  • Collaborate with frontend, AI, and product teams to support seamless design exports and animated content delivery
  • Own system reliability, observability, and cost-efficiency of backend infrastructure
  • Ensure cloud-based production systems are secure, fault-tolerant, and well-monitored

Requirements

  • 8+ years of backend development experience with Java (Spring Boot) and Node.js
  • Hands-on experience with AWS services, including Lambda, S3, EC2, SQS, MediaConvert, etc.
  • Strong knowledge of microservices and event-driven architectures
  • Experience with media processing tools like FFmpeg, canvas-node, or video transcoding pipelines
  • Deep understanding of API design, asynchronous processing, and REST best practices
  • Proven ability to build high-throughput, low-latency systems for handling large files (images, video, animations)

Bonus Skills

  • Experience building design, media, or creative SaaS platforms
  • Familiarity with video codecs, SVG rendering, or Lottie animations
  • Experience with CI/CD pipelines, infrastructure as code (Terraform, CloudFormation), and Docker/Kubernetes
  • Exposure to AI-powered media workflows or real-time rendering

Preferred Qualifications

  • 8+ years of professional experience building scalable backend systems for SaaS platforms
  • Prior experience supporting production systems in a high-growth startup or scaled product environment

Why Join them 

  • Build a next-generation creative platform used by global design teams
    Collaborate with world-class engineers, designers, and entrepreneurs
  • Take ownership in a fast-moving, product-focused environment
    Competitive compensation and flexible remote/hybrid work
  • Join a growth-minded, impact-driven culture with room to lead and innovate